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
289 818058578 48820774646
0505829410 59 12
0505829410 59 12
667901 594875726 672120994 795
All about undefined
Interested in learning more?
0505829410 59 12
667901 594875726 672120994 795
See more
57609711 5950345 71770
0508739672 04 52354
See more
3333478 4196
5043622 80533740 4309781802
See more